WebNereis dumerilii is carnivorous and devours small animals like crustacea and small molluscs. It seizes the food by means of jaws and teeth. The entire bucco-pharyngeal region during capture of prey is everted out. The eversion is caused by the pressure of coelomic fluid and contraction of protractor muscles. WebSegmented Worms (Phylum Annelida) Annelids are bilateral, coelomate protostomes. The coelom is partitioned by septa (crosswalls). The fluid-filled coelom acts as a hydrostatic skeleton. The clam worm can reach up to 15 centimetres (6 in) in length, but most specimens are smaller than this. It is brown colored at the rear, and reddish-brown on the rest of its body. It has an identifiable head with four eyes, two sensory feelers or palps, and many tentacles. The head consists of two segments: the anterior and posterior prostomium. WebPH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S. Clam worms, sand worms, and tubeworms range in length from 0.078 inches to 9.8 feet (2 to 300 millimeters). Their bodies consist of a head, body trunk, and tail. Most species have long, segmented bodies that are tubelike and covered with bristles. Along the sides of their bodies are flaps that help them to swim, …

Webrag worm, also called clam worm (genus Nereis), any of a group of mostly marine or shore worms of the class Polychaeta (phylum Annelida). A few species live in fresh water. Other common names include mussel worm, pileworm, and sandworm. Alitta succinea, also known as the pile worm or clam worm, is a common polychaete worm. It is a species of ragworm or sandworm. The terms can refer to any one of a number of other species. This worm can reach up to 15 centimeters (6 inches) in length. Most specimens are smaller than this.
